Output d792cf57cbe5f979024eae537fc22ffb2a5c9e1c4d2ea10717d9066b39725635:6

value
14038263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 251a13eb1e00513715e34dad5a5538d1f299c389 OP_EQUAL
address
MBHLUSoU4SvaaEk3gjpHydBjykyADqMCrz
transaction
d792cf57cbe5f979024eae537fc22ffb2a5c9e1c4d2ea10717d9066b39725635
spent
true